设备管理器一片空白的研究解决.docx

上传人:b****5 文档编号:8400903 上传时间:2023-01-31 格式:DOCX 页数:8 大小:1.36MB
下载 相关 举报
设备管理器一片空白的研究解决.docx_第1页
第1页 / 共8页
设备管理器一片空白的研究解决.docx_第2页
第2页 / 共8页
设备管理器一片空白的研究解决.docx_第3页
第3页 / 共8页
设备管理器一片空白的研究解决.docx_第4页
第4页 / 共8页
设备管理器一片空白的研究解决.docx_第5页
第5页 / 共8页
点击查看更多>>
下载资源
资源描述

设备管理器一片空白的研究解决.docx

《设备管理器一片空白的研究解决.docx》由会员分享,可在线阅读,更多相关《设备管理器一片空白的研究解决.docx(8页珍藏版)》请在冰豆网上搜索。

设备管理器一片空白的研究解决.docx

设备管理器一片空白的研究解决

研究解决,设备管理器一片空白,本地服务全部已禁用,网络连接空白

今天遇到一个很夸张的问题,之前从未遇见过,具体如何夸张,咱们看以下截图。

1.设备管理器,显示为一片空白,看不到任何硬件设备,声卡、网卡无法使用,无声、无网。

2.服务和应用程序,只有3个显示为“已启动”,其余全部显示“已禁用”,包括“PlugandPlay”。

3.网络连接,显示为一片空白,本地连接、宽带连接不知道死哪去了。

4.磁盘管理。

显示为一片空白,显示无法连接到裸机磁盘管理器服务,但是“我的电脑”内却可以看见磁盘分区。

5.性能日志和警报,无法打开无法查看。

……………………

还有很多夸张的地方,比如“本地安全策略”空白等,因为我截的图没有这个,所以就不具体指明了,我今天只说我截图的部分。

说真的,遇到这样的问题,没必要去搞什么修复了,没多大意义,除非是你的机子真的是不能动的那种,像搞税控的机子就这样,还有些电脑装的行业专用软件,这样是实在动不得,那只能是修复。

寻常人用的机子,甭管什么,直接做系统得了,省事干净利索。

但是对于这问题,难得一遇,就这样以重装系统告终,甚是可惜,修电脑的人的职业病就这样。

所以把顾客打发走,自己闷头研究了下,小有发现,写下来,相信会有人用到的。

------------------------------------------------------------------------------------------------------------------------------------------------------------------

遇到这问题,先XX了下,我XX“本地服务全部已禁用”,一条相关信息都没有,又XX“设备管理器显示空白”,这下出现的多了,我一条一条往下看,这些人把一片文章转来转去,是一模一样,字都不变一个…………我把网上的方法贴出来:

------------------------------------------------------------------------------------------------------------------------------------------------------------------

1.启动PlugandPlay服务(即插即用服务)

      在“开始”菜单,单击运行,键入services.msc,然后单击确定。

或者在桌面我的电脑点击右键,选择“管理”,然后在“服务和应用程序”里面选择“服务”,在右侧找到“PlugandPlay”,启动该服务。

如果收到配置管理器消息,请单击确定。

在启动类型列表中,单击自动,然后单击确定。

关闭服务。

重新启动计算机。

2.修改注册表

     在注册表中打开:

HKEY_CURRENT_USER\Software\Microsoft\InternetExplorer\Toolbar找到如下3个子键:

explorershellbrowerwebbrower的每个itbarlayout删除。

这些键值是WIN自动重新生成的。

放心删除不用担心。

关闭注册表,重新打开就有了。

3.修复损坏的系统文件

     先用EXPAND命令在“命令提示符”窗口中,将XP安装盘里的SERVICES.EX_,转换成正常的services.exe,然后进入纯DOS,用新提取出来的services.exe替换C:

\windows\system32\services.exe

也有可能是你的“设备管理器”文件损坏了,“设备管理器”文件通常位置为“c:

\winnt\system32\devmgmt.msc”(假设操作系统装在C区,如果是WinXP或Win2003则在C:

\windows\system32\下),单击“开始”-“运行”,在其中输入“devmgmt.msc”即可运行“设备管理器”,你可以从别的机器上将该文件拷贝一个过来,或者在“运行”中输入“sfc/scannow”运行“文件检查器”,根据提示插入系统光盘即可

4.最后一步的解决方案:

如果你在第一步里根本找不到PlugandPlay服务,2、3步也正常或解决不了你的问题!

从正常电脑中导出H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\PlugPlay分支,导入自己电脑,

如导入以上分支重启后还是不能解决问题,把如下几个分支也从好的电脑(XP系统)导出然后导入自己的电脑。

H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001

H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002

HKEY_LOCAL_MACHINE\SYSTEM\ControlSet003

------------------------------------------------------------------------------------------------------------------------------------------------------------------

第一条,略过,经过实验,所有已被禁用的服务都无法启用,我截了张启用打印机的图,与启动PlugandPlay服务是一样的,:

而第二项,[HKEY_CURRENT_USER\\Software\\Microsoft\\InternetExplorer\\Toolbar],这一条注册表项目,是设置IE菜单工具栏的,不明白怎么会把它和今天这个问题扯到一起的?

我可以简单说下这条注册表的一些应用。

比如"Locked"=dword:

00000001,这个是锁定工具栏,又比如"BackBitmap(字符串值)"="输入盘符\\文件夹名称\\tubularcopy.bmp",这个可以手动添加,右键以编辑方式打开可以更改IE背景,即为你用来替代工具栏背景图案文件的全称(包括路径及文件名)。

……………………等等,这里就不多说了。

再说第三条,囧~~从别的机子上拷一份过来不省事了吗,更何况,系统版本不同,转换的services.exe文件也有差别的。

再退一步说,如果说你没其他机子,只能转换,那下面干嘛又说“拷贝一个devmgmt.msc文件”,从哪拷?

没其他机子的话,也不用看第四步了。

没有其他机器,你现在也不会在上网看我这篇文章了。

至于假设的“设备管理器”文件损坏,直接略过,因为经过md5哈希值比较,确认devmgmt.msc文件是完好的,当然为了谨防起见,我还是替换了下devmgmt.msc,重启机子,设备管理器依旧空白。

第四步,这个步骤,思路正确,我赞同,实际上,只需要在下面三项中找到PlugandPlay,右键“导出”,拷到出问题的电脑中,再导入就行了。

  HKEY_LOCAL_MACHINE->SYSTEM->ControlSet001->Services

  HKEY_LOCAL_MACHINE->SYSTEM->ControlSet002->Services

  HKEY_LOCAL_MACHINE->SYSTEM->CurrentControlSet->Services

如果嫌上面导来导去的麻烦,就将下面蓝色代码复制记事本,另存为“XXX.reg”,再双击双击导入注册表,(这只是一个正常的“PlugandPlay服务”的注册表项,我提取了正常电脑上的数值。

WindowsRegistryEditorVersion5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\PlugPlay]

"Description"="使计算机在极少或没有用户输入的情况下能识别并适应硬件的更改。

终止或禁用此服务会造成系统不稳定。

"

"DisplayName"="PlugandPlay"

"ErrorControl"=dword:

00000001

"Group"="PlugPlay"

"ImagePath"=hex

(2):

25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,\

74,00,25,00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,73,\

00,65,00,72,00,76,00,69,00,63,00,65,00,73,00,2e,00,65,00,78,00,65,00,00,00

"ObjectName"="LocalSystem"

"PlugPlayServiceType"=dword:

00000003

"Start"=dword:

00000002

"Type"=dword:

00000020

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\PlugPlay\Security]

"Security"=hex:

01,00,14,80,90,00,00,00,9c,00,00,00,14,00,00,00,30,00,00,00,02,\

00,1c,00,01,00,00,00,02,80,14,00,ff,01,0f,00,01,01,00,00,00,00,00,01,00,00,\

00,00,02,00,60,00,04,00,00,00,00,00,14,00,8d,01,02,00,01,01,00,00,00,00,00,\

05,0b,00,00,00,00,00,18,00,9d,01,02,00,01,02,00,00,00,00,00,05,20,00,00,00,\

23,02,00,00,00,00,18,00,ff,01,0f,00,01,02,00,00,00,00,00,05,20,00,00,00,20,\

02,00,00,00,00,14,00,fd,01,02,00,01,01,00,00,00,00,00,05,12,00,00,00,01,01,\

00,00,00,00,00,05,12,00,00,00,01,01,00,00,00,00,00,05,12,00,00,00

但是,第四步有个前提条件,C:

\WINDOWS\system32目录下必须要有service.exe文件,也就是第三部所说的,只有service.exe在的情况下才能导入reg注册表文件,否则,第四步就是废话。

------------------------------------------------------------------------------------------------------------------------------------------------------------------

还有某些人说运行[for%1in(%windir%\system32\*.dll)doregsvr32.exe/s%1],重新注册C:

\Windows\system32文件夹下的所有dll文件,包括很多人电脑常出现“0X000000该内存不能为read”,也在使用这个指令。

这里说一下,请大家慎用该指令,该指令是恢复DLL文件初始状态的,且不说,恢复后能否解决以上问题,恢复DLL可能会引起很多未知的问题产生。

当然,也许有用的到的,简单起见,可以把指令写成BAT处理,

for%%ain(%windir%\system32\*.dll)doregsvr32.exe/s%%a

复制到记事本,另存为文件名“regsvr32.bat”就行了。

 

设备管理器空白的解决办法

一个用户的WINXP系统出现了以下问题:

1。

设备管理器一片空白

2。

声卡不能用了

3。

网络连接一片空白

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 初中教育

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1